AUM Drops Home Finale To UWA, 75-61

The Warhawks honored their five seniors prior to the game

MONTGOMERY, Ala. - The AUM men's basketball team fell to West Alabama, 75-61, on Senior Day at the AUM Athletics Complex on Saturday.

UWA pulled out to a 31-9 lead as AUM struggled to make shots. The Warhawks battled back to within 38-24 at the half. UWA shot 52 percent in the opening 20 minutes compared to 29 percent for AUM.

In the second half, AUM came out on fire, making a pair of 3-pointers and two dunks to pull within 42-36 just 3:40 into the period. But UWA answered and got the lead back to 14 points a few minutes later. The Warhawks fought back to another 6-point margin with 5:26 remaining but were unable to get any closer.

AUM is now 9-16 overall and 6-14 in the Gulf South Conference, sitting in a tie for eighth place with two games remaining.

Trent Coleman tied his season-high with 23 points, while adding 11 rebounds for his fourth double-double of the season. He has scored 45 points in the last two games. Malachi Rhodes added 12 points and nine boards.

UWA improved to 13-13 and 10-11.Thaddeus Williams led the Tigers with 17 points and 13 rebounds. UWA shot 44 percent in the game and was 9-of-21 from outside.

AUM will travel to Valdosta State on Thursday and West Florida on Saturday to close out the regular-season. The top eight teams will qualify for the Truist GSC Championship.
